For full pivoting the entire submatrix is searched for the largest element, which is then positioned into the diagonal. If this involves a column interchange, then the unknowns must be renumbered. WebApr 7, 2014 · Now I want to use full-pivoting with both row- and column-swapping. When I swap two rows in the source matrix I swap the same two rows in the result matrix as well. What I don't get and couldn't find is how a column swap affects the result matrix.
